How Workers Compensation Laws work in California
California uses a no-fault system to process compensation for injuries directly related to employment. The laws apply to any illness, injury, or disability provided the accident took place in the line of duty.
The employer is required by law to pay a worker’s compensation package to an insurance company to cover eligible employees. Although the employee seeking compensation does not need a lawyer, they can acquire legal services in case of denial or other complication issues.

Compensation Benefits for Workers in California
There are several benefits for employees, depending on the type of injury one suffers in a workplace accident. Labor laws in California require employers to cover medical bills, lost wages due to absence from work, future medical care, as well as pain and suffering.
Additionally, other benefits include temporary disability benefits, permanent disability benefits, rehabilitation benefits, and death benefits. The death benefits usually go to the employee’s next of kin or family members.
